We saw it with Christian Bale, Matt Damon, and the director and some of the cast in the balcony next to us. Movie got a standing ovation. Roy Thomson Hall was filled to the roof.
Matt Damon played a passable Shelby. There were times he got the accent and voice just right. I closed my eyes and thought I was listening to Shelby giving a speech at a SAAC dinner. He's too short and we only knew Shelby as an old man, but I think I think he would approve. He had lots of balls in the air in '64 and '65 and they capture how he had to deal with all that. Some of the original crew can comment.
I never met Ken Miles but from all I've read, Chritian Bale nailed it. He lost 70 pounds after his role in "Vice" to play on older, skinny British race car driver who did not suffer fools gladly. He must have spent a lot of time speaking to the Miles family.
Leo Beebe is portrayed as the villain. We met him one year; I'm not sure if he gets a fair shake in the script but it makes a better story. Same with HF2 Ferrari etc. But they do tell the whole story about the attempt by Ford to buy Ferrari.
The biggest mistake is everyone sits in Cobra fenders and hoods and jump over doors etc. which no one ever does but it looks cool. The audience howled when Shelby takes Ford for a ride in a Mk2. The racing scenes were fantastic.
